CR set up semi-final clash with CH By Lal Gunesekera Caltex League runners-up CR & FC set up a semi-final clash with CH & FC after a comfortable 41 points (4 goals, 2 tries, 1 penalty) to 8 (1 try, 1 penalty) victory at Longdon Place yesterday after leading 13-3 at half time. In their Caltex Clifford Cup rugby quarter-final game. After a good contest in the first session where CR managed to score only two tries through left winger Sheriff and their replacement prop as well as a penalty through Pushpakumara, CR, four more tries in the second half through scrum-half Nauffer, Pushpakumara, winger Mushtaq and right winger Musaffer with Pushpakumara converting all four tries. In the first session, Hettiaratchi, put over a fine 40-metre penalty for Police, who managed to score late in the second session through one of their forwards. CR's Walpola and the Police centre were sent into Sin Bin in the latter stages of the first session. Aruna Jayasekera refereed. In the other game at Police Park, CH & FC beat Navy by 24 points (2 goals, 2 tries) to nil after a scoreless first half. Milinda Jayasinghe (2), Madipola (1) and Berty Jayasekera (1) scored the tries for CH with Nalin Dissanayake and Wijeweera converting a try each. Orville Fernando refereed. In the first semi-final on Tuesday, Kandy SC play Army at Nittawela,
while in the second on Wednesday at Havelock Park, CR battle CH. |
